‘Impact of cancer on outcomes following breakthrough ischaemic stroke on oral anticoagulants for atrial fibrillation: insights from the ASPERA-R study’ has been published in the European Stroke Journal.
This publication represents a very special milestone for us — it is the first published paper from the ASPERA-R study, the international collaborative effort investigating breakthrough ischemic stroke despite oral anticoagulation in patients with atrial fibrillation.
And this is only the beginning: several additional ASPERA analyses will be released soon .
Key findings
- Cancer significantly worsens prognosis after breakthrough ischemic stroke despite oral anticoagulation.
- Patients with cancer had more than twice the risk of recurrent stroke or TIA within 90 days compared with those without cancer.
- Cancer was associated with worse functional outcomes, highlighting a more vulnerable clinical phenotype.
- Bleeding risk was also increased, emphasizing the delicate balance between thrombosis and hemorrhage in this population.
- Active and haematological cancers emerged as the highest-risk conditions, suggesting the need for personalized secondary prevention strategies.”
